| An issue was discovered in Lantronix EDS3000PS 3.1.0.0R2. The authentication on management pages can be bypassed by appending a specific suffix to the URL and by sending an Authorization header that uses "admin" as the username. |
| An issue was discovered in Lantronix EDS3000PS 3.1.0.0R2. The host parameter of the TFTP client in the Filesystem Browser page is not properly sanitized. This can be exploited to escape from the original command and execute an arbitrary one with root privileges. |
| In Microsoft DirectX End-User Runtime Web Installer 9.29.1974.0, a low-privilege user can replace an executable file during the installation process, which may result in unintended elevation of privileges. During installation, the installer runs with HIGH integrity and downloads executables and DLLs to the %TEMP% folder - writable by standard users. Subsequently, the installer executes the downloaded executable with HIGH integrity to complete the application installation. However, an attacker can replace the downloaded executable with a malicious, user-controlled executable. When the installer executes this replaced file, it runs the attacker's code with HIGH integrity. Since code running at HIGH integrity can escalate to SYSTEM level by registering and executing a service, this creates a complete privilege escalation chain from standard user to SYSTEM. NOTE: The Supplier disputes this record stating that they have determined this to be the behavior as designed. |

| Traefik is an HTTP reverse proxy and load balancer. Versions 2.11.40 and below, 3.0.0-beta1 through 3.6.11, and 3.7.0-ea.1 are vulnerable to mTLS bypass through the TLS SNI pre-sniffing logic related to fragmented ClientHello packets. When a TLS ClientHello is fragmented across multiple records, Traefik's SNI extraction may fail with an EOF and return an empty SNI. The TCP router then falls back to the default TLS configuration, which does not require client certificates by default. This allows an attacker to bypass route-level mTLS enforcement and access services that should require mutual TLS authentication. This issue is patched in versions 2.11.41, 3.6.11 and 3.7.0-ea.2. |
| Frigate is a network video recorder (NVR) with realtime local object detection for IP cameras. Versions prior to 0.17.0-beta1 allow any authenticated user to change their own password without verifying the current password through the /users/{username}/password endpoint. Changing a password does not invalidate existing JWT tokens, and there is no validation of password strength. If an attacker obtains a valid session token (e.g., via accidentally exposed JWT, stolen cookie, XSS, compromised device, or sniffing over HTTP), they can change the victim’s password and gain permanent control of the account. Since password changes do not invalidate existing JWT tokens, session hijacks persist even after a password reset. Additionally, the lack of password strength validation exposes accounts to brute-force attacks. This issue has been resolved in version 0.17.0-beta1. |
